Default short shifter only shorterned distance for 2and4

I just install a ralco rz short shifter on my tc (my brother bought it for me really didnt have a choice), it lowered the height of the stick by maybe an inch with the stock know, it feels diferent from stock bc there is no bend in it so the position of the stick needs a bit of getting used or maybe ill bend it. but my problem is that the shift from neutral to 2/4/r is extremely short which is what i expected but from neutral to 1st 3rd and 5th are noticably longer very comparable to stock. is this normal on all short shifters that the lengths are different between 1/3/5 and 2/4/r.

http://www.ultrarev.com/product.php?productid=77965

i also put the ralco rz shifter on my celica befor ei put it on my tc and it is pretty much perfect all the shifts are the same length and really really short, and i was little dispointed that the quality of the shifts werent the same between the two cars

i bought my fidanza short shifter from ultrarev. near stock heigth. The bottom half of the shifter should be longer than stock. if not, all you got was a chopped and rethreaded stock one....
